Default Re: Cosmos from my point of view

The detail in the center should be crystal clear and the color is too magenta missing much of the "yellow/red" spectrum..I know this flower very well and the green is too "flush"

Lastly, tell tale..the flower in behind is almost "blown"..
Just ...especially on sunny days bracket your shots, in this case by 1/2 a stop...use the manual mode if your using the R9..also there is a great "exposure compensation" feature on both the R8 and R9...but..remember to put it back to the center point after your done..or you'll forget.
